What are the check‑in and check‑out times?

Arrive from 3PM. Leave by 11AM.

How many people can stay?

The space is designed for two. A small child or pet can be accommodated comfortably. We simply ask that you leave the space as you found it.

What’s included in the stay?

A fully prepared solar caravan, fresh linen, a Korean barbecue setup for self‑cooking, coffee for the morning, air conditioning, exterior bathroom, and time to yourself.

On‑site parking is available at HKD 100 per night.

What should I bring?

Comfortable clothes, toiletries, towels, a good book, and anything you’d like to eat or drink.
